Embarking on the Complexities of Payment Security

The digital age presents a golden age for commerce, enabling seamless transactions across international borders. However, this unprecedented linkage also introduces significant challenges to payment security. Cyber actors are continually adapting their tactics, seeking to exploit vulnerabilities and steal sensitive financial data. To mitigate these risks, businesses must implement robust security measures that encompass a multifaceted approach.

First and foremost, it's crucial to guarantee the security of your payment platform. This involves leveraging cutting-edge encryption technologies and implementing multi-factor authentication to shield unauthorized access. Furthermore, regular security reviews can reveal potential weaknesses, allowing for preemptive remediation. Training employees on best practices and fostering a culture of security awareness is also paramount.

By embracing these strategies, businesses can fortify their defenses against the ever-evolving threat landscape and preserve their customers' financial safety.

Developing a Robust Payment Infrastructure for Your Business

A solid payment infrastructure is critical for any business that handles payments. It guarantees smooth transactions, lowers risk, and boosts the overall customer journey. Implementing a robust payment system involves carefully identifying the right providers, linking them with your systems, and establishing secure measures to protect sensitive customer data.

  • Focus on security: Implement robust encryption measures to protect customer data from fraudulent access.
  • Support multiple payment methods: Meet the needs of diverse customers by offering a variety of popular payment options, such as credit cards, debit cards, digital wallets, and emerging payment methods.
  • Provide seamless integration: Optimize the payment process by connecting your payment system with your existing website for a smooth and user-friendly customer experience.
  • Track transactions regularly: Stay informed transaction patterns to identify potential issues and resolve them.
